Nieuw-Buinen Oost is a spacious residential neighbourhood in Borger-Odoorn with 1,120 residents. Measured against every neighbourhood in the Netherlands, it scores 4.3 out of 10. The profile is pronounced: safety scores 8.8, while socio-economic position lags at 3.6. Housing is relatively affordable here, with an average property value of €257k.

Frequently asked questions

How is the grade for Nieuw-Buinen Oost calculated?

Nieuw-Buinen Oost scores 4.3 overall. That is a weighted average of five pillars: safety, amenities, housing, social & income, and nature & quiet. Each pillar compares this neighbourhood with every other neighbourhood in the Netherlands, using open data from CBS and the police.

Is Nieuw-Buinen Oost a safe neighbourhood?

Nieuw-Buinen Oost scores 8.8 on safety, based on registered crimes per 1,000 people present (16.1 per year). The national median is around 24.1.
